Practical Applications

In marketing, practical applications of AI are vast. Here are a few examples:

Email Marketing Optimization

AI can analyze customer data to personalize email content, subject lines, and send times, increasing open rates and conversions.

Customer Journey Personalization

Using AI to track and analyze customer interactions across multiple channels enables marketers to create a more personalized shopping experience, which can lead to increased customer loyalty and sales.

Ad Targeting and Spend Optimization

AI algorithms can optimize ad targeting based on user behavior and preferences, ensuring that marketing budgets are spent on ads that convert.

Common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them

While AI offers significant advantages, certain pitfalls can hinder its effectiveness:

Lack of Clear Goals

Implementing AI without specific objectives can lead to wasted resources. Always set clear, measurable goals for what you want AI to achieve in your marketing strategy.

Data Quality Issues

AI is only as good as the data it processes. Ensure the data is accurate, comprehensive, and clean to prevent AI from drawing incorrect conclusions.

Ignoring Ethical Considerations

AI can raise ethical issues, particularly around privacy and bias. Adhere to ethical guidelines and privacy laws to build trust and protect your brand reputation.

Measuring Impact and Success

To truly understand the impact of AI on ROI, robust measurement and analytics are essential. This involves setting up key performance indicators (KPIs) related to AI initiatives and regularly monitoring them.

Conversion Rates and Customer Engagement

Track how AI implementations affect conversion rates and customer engagement metrics. An increase in these areas often correlates with a higher ROI.

Cost Savings

Measure cost savings resulting from AI-driven efficiencies, such as reduced man-hours due to automation or lower customer acquisition costs.

Customer Satisfaction

Use customer feedback and satisfaction scores to gauge the effectiveness of AI-driven personalization and customer service initiatives.
